Smiliinae
Smiliinae is a subfamily of treehoppers in the family Membracidae. These are Hemiptera, bugs and include about 100 genera in 10 tribes. Treehopper
Treehoppers (more precisely typical treehoppers to distinguish them from the Aetalionidae) and thorn bugs are members of the family (biology), family Membracidae, a group of insects related to the cicadas and the leafhoppers. About 3,200 species of treehoppers in over 400 genera are known.Treehoppers.
Dr. Metcalf. NCSU Libraries. North Carolina State University.
They are found on all continents except Antarctica; only five species are known from Europe. Individual treehoppers usually live for only a few months.

Vanduzea
''Vanduzea'' is a genus of treehoppers in the family Membracidae. There are about 12 described species in ''Vanduzea''.
